Table of Contents:
  • Newton's law, gravity, energy, electromagnetism, special relativity
  • Electromagnetic waves, blackbody radiation, early spectroscopy, the Rutherford atom, Bohr's quantum model, De Broglie's matter waves
  • The two-slit experiment Schroedinger's wave equation, probabilistic interpretation, a brief survey of the rules, communting observables, the uncertainty principle, momentum, the operator concept, angular momentum, aspects of energy
  • The free particle, particle in a box, the harmonic oscillator, central potentials generally, the one-electron atom, the infinite solenoid, decay processes
  • Symmetry, antisymmetry rules, the Pauli principle, the Fermi gas, atoms, more on identical Bosons
  • Particles in collistion, particles in decay, accelerators, patterns and regularities, basic ingredients, summary
  • Free fields, free particles, interactions, Feynman diagrams, virtual particles, the standard model in diagrams.
